Have to give this one a two. Which is sad because I really liked the first book in the series. However after reading this book I came away feeling cheated and slightly dirty.
The hero Brandon has endured a horrible past and final has a moment of freedom from his family when his friend and a guy we all trust Rene betrays him and gets him sent back. Then he has the nerve to go back and tell the guy's sister that he tried to save him but he just couldn't. Not a great ending and it totally wrecked the book... However it does force you to keep reading cause you need to find out what will happen to Brandon, the guy who just can't get a brake.
